Regular Cleaning and Care

Keeping your camera clean is vital for its longevity. Dust, dirt, and fingerprints can affect performance and image quality. Use a soft, lint-free cloth to wipe the exterior regularly. For the lens, employ a gentle lens cleaning solution and a microfiber c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als that could damage the camera's surfaces.

Proper Storage Techniques

Store your Canon R8 2026 in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Use a dedicated camera bag or case to protect it from dust and physical damage. When not in use for extended periods, remove the battery to prevent leakage and store it separately in a charged state.

Battery Maintenance

The battery is a critical component that affects camera performance. Charge the battery before it fully depletes and avoid overcharging. Use only the recommended chargers and avoid exposing the battery to extreme temperatures. Regularly check for signs of swelling or corrosion and replace the battery if needed.

Firmware Updates

Keeping your camera's firmware up to date ensures optimal performance and security. Check periodically on the Canon website or through the camera's menu system for updates. Follow the manufacturer's instructions carefully during the update process to prevent potential issues.

Handling and Usage Tips

Handle your Canon R8 2026 with care. Use both hands when shooting to stabilize the camera. Avoid sudden impacts or drops. When changing lenses, do so in a clean environment to prevent dust from entering the camera body. Use lens caps and body caps when not in use.

Scheduled Maintenance and Professional Servicing

Periodically, have your camera professionally serviced to check for internal issues and ensure all components are functioning correctly. Regular maintenance can prevent costly repairs and extend the life of your device.
